Teaching in Today's Classrooms: Cases From Middle and Secondary School by George L. Redman
This text contains brief teaching cases from middle and secondary classrooms, grouped by theme, to be used as a supplement in middle and secondary methods and curriculum courses. The cases in this collection are problem-based, engaging stories of authentic classroom situations. Because the situations are generic, they are relevant to teachers and prospective teachers in grades 6-12 throughout the full range of subject matter areas. The approach of the text is to invite prospective teachers are invited to become active inquirers in their study of teaching.
